CSC 355: Human Computer Interaction

Offered Occasionally

Course Units: 1

Description:
This course will cover various aspects of the interaction between computer systems and human operators. Topics covered will include the underlying principles for human computer interaction, from aspects of human perception and memory, to user interface design. The course will culminate in a final project in which students will design and implement their own HCI applications.

Prerequisite notes: CSC 230, CSC 270, and MAT 127, each with a grade of C or higher.  Non-majors may use CSC 250 in lieu of CSC 230.

Required for major/minor: None

Option for major/minor: Computer Science Major, Computer Science Minor
